Money, Motherhood and Menopause


Listen Later

Despite her aversion to discussing finances, real estate agent Kristin is determined to secure her children’s future and ensure a comfortable retirement. As she navigates the challenges of perimenopause, Kristin candidly discusses how these life changes intersect with her financial journey with Sarah, a Morgan Stanley Financial Advisor.
